WebThe Duval County Courthouseis the local courthousefor Duval County, Florida. It houses courtrooms and judges from the Duval County and Fourth Judicial CircuitCourts. The new facility is located DowntownJacksonville, … WebDuval County Courthouse 501 West Adams Street Jacksonville, FL 32202 Fax: 904-255-1026 [email protected]
